Turmeric Hummus Recipe
Have you ever made your own hummus? It is super easy and delicious. Plus, you can add turmeric to make it even better. To make turmeric hummus, you need chickpeas, tahini, lemon juice, garlic, and turmeric. First, blend the chickpeas, tahini, lemon juice, and garlic in a food processor. Then, add a pinch of turmeric and blend again. Taste it and add more turmeric if you want. You can serve the hummus with veggies, pita bread, or crackers. Potential Side Effects and Precautions
Even though turmeric is good for you, there are a few things to keep in mind. Some people might have tummy troubles if they eat too much turmeric. It can cause things like gas or bloating. Also, turmeric can interact with some medicines. If you are taking any medicines, talk to your doctor before adding turmeric to your diet. And if you are allergic to ginger, you might also be allergic to turmeric. Start with a small amount and see how you feel. Can Turmeric Affect My Medicines?
Did you know that some foods can affect how your medicines work? Turmeric is one of those foods. It can interact with certain medicines, especially blood thinners. If you are taking any medicines, it is important to talk to your doctor before adding turmeric to your diet. They can tell you if there are any potential interactions. What If I’m Allergic to Ginger?
Are you allergic to ginger? If you are, you might also be allergic to turmeric. Ginger and turmeric are in the same plant family. This means they have similar properties. If you have never tried turmeric before, start with a very small amount. Watch for any signs of an allergic reaction, such as itching, hives, or swelling. If you notice any of these symptoms, stop using turmeric and talk to your doctor. For your energy packed lunches with turmeric, it is important to be aware of your allergies and take precautions.
